I find that highly unlikely, but it seems Ertz has very good things to say about how Bradford is looking, though he acknowledges his leg is not 100%.

Kissing the ass of his new QB? Probable. Still, interesting...

“We’ve been throwing for the past three weeks and I can honestly say I’ve thrown with Andrew, Nick and other guys, and I don’t think I’ve thrown with a guy who has a stronger arm than Sam Bradford,” Ertz said.

“He hasn’t been able to really truly get his full legs underneath him. But the ball still comes out effortlessly, and it’s a lot of fun to run routes with him.”

I've never thought Luck had a rocket for an arm ... it's good enough, but his forte is decisions, anticipation and putting the ball in good spots. Bradford having a better arm to me isn't any kind of revelation. Bradford never had a good OL in St Louis and he didn't play in a spread like he will here. Here he'll have a much better line than he ever had with the Rams, will be in an Offense similar to what he ran in college and will have plenty of Offensive pieces including one of the best running games in the league. Night and day from what he had in St Louis.
